The final print on multiple decals does not match what I see in Production manager

gabagoo

New Member
I have used Flexi long enough that I would think I would have saw this before. I ran 250 odd decals and I fill the cutting area fully. when the printer finished it changed the layout and left one row with 6 or so not printed, yet they were all there. I can't think of a reason why it did this and also wonder what happens when I go to cut them. I wasn't going to waste any more time and turfed them and started again ( small decals). Anybody have an idea why it did this?

My first guess is there is a conflict between Flexi and PM. For example, if Flexi is set to manually set the media width to say, 54" but PM is set to automatically get the width from the printer at 50", it will re-nest before sending to the printer.

Like Solventinkjet already said. It has happened to me before and you just need to make sure you click on Poll Size every time you start a new print and/or cut job just to make sure it detects the correct media width.
